A, B and C are in the hand. C is all in making A and B practically heads up. A bets and action is on B. Before B has acted A shows his cards to his neighbor who is not in the hand. D who is not in the hand invokes "show one show all".

1) How should the dealer proceed?
2) What does the etiquette say on this situation?
3) What do the rules say on this situation?
08-20-2013 , 09:01 AM
Dealer makes sure that Player A's cards are shown once all action is complete.
